Padmé stared at her older sister until, at last, Sola broke down and asked, “What?”
The two of them were alone together, while Jobal and Ruwee entertained Anakin out in the sitting room.
“Why do you keep saying such things about me and Anakin?”
“Because it’s obvious,” Sola replied. “You see it—you can’t deny it to yourself.”
Padmé sighed and sat down on the bed, her posture and expression giving all the confirmation that Sola needed.
“I thought Jedi weren’t supposed to think such things,” Sola remarked.
“They’re not.”
“But Anakin does.” Sola’s words brought Padmé’s gaze up to meet hers. “You know I’m right.”
Padmé shook her head helplessly, and Sola laughed.
“You think more like a Jedi than he does,” she said. “And you shouldn’t.”
“What do you mean?” Padmé didn’t know whether to take offense, having no idea of where her sister was heading with this.
“You’re so tied up in your responsibilities that you don’t give any weight to your desires,” Sola explained. “Even with your own feelings toward Anakin.”
“You don’t know how I feel about Anakin.”
“You probably don’t either,” Sola said. “Because you won’t allow yourself to even think about it. Being a Senator and being a girlfriend aren’t mutually exclusive, you know.”
“My work is important!”
“Who said it wasn’t?” Sola asked, holding her hands up in a gesture of peace. “It’s funny, Padmé, because you act as if you’re prohibited, and you’re not, while Anakin acts as if he’s under no such prohibitions, and he is!”
“You’re way ahead of everything here,” Padmé said. “Anakin and I have only been together for a few days—before that, I hadn’t seen him in a decade!”
Sola shrugged. Her look went from that sly grin she had been sporting since dinner to one of more genuine concern for her sister. She sat down on the bed beside Padmé and draped an arm across her shoulders. “I don’t know any of the details, and you’re right, I don’t know how you feel—about any of this. But I know how he feels, and so do you.”
Padmé didn’t disagree. She just sat there, comfortable in Sola’s hug, gazing down at the floor, trying not to think.
“It frightens you,” Sola remarked. Surprised, Padmé looked back up.
“What are you afraid of, Sis?” Sola asked sincerely. “Are you afraid of Anakin’s feelings and the responsibilities that he cannot dismiss? Or are you afraid of your own feelings?”
She lifted Padmé’s chin, so that they were looking at each other directly, their faces only a breath apart. “I don’t know how you feel,” she admitted again. “But I suspect that it’s something new to you. Something scary, but something wonderful.”
Padmé said nothing, but she knew that disagreement would not be honest.
